Services
Enable or disable accessibility services.
TalkBack
From the Accessibility screen, under Services, touch
the following option:
• TalkBack: When this option is enabled in the TalkBack screen,
the phone recites menu options, application titles, contacts,
and other items when scrolling and making selections,
according to the Settings values you select.

Vision
From the Accessibility screen, under Vision, touch the
check box next to each of the following options to
enable it. (When an option is enabled, a check mark
appears in the check box.)
• Font size: Set the font size for screen displays (Tiny, Small,
Normal, Large, Huge).
• Negative colors: Reverses the colors on the screen.
• Text-to-speech output: Select Preferred TTS engine,
Speech rate, Listen to an example, and Driving mode.
• Enhance web accessibility: Does not allow / Allows apps to
install scripts from Google that make their Web content more
accessible.
